The volume of a right circular cone is 300 cubic inches. What is the volume, in cubic inches, of a right cylinder that
has the same base and height as the cone?

Answer:

The volume of a right cylinder is equal to the 3 times of the volume of a right circular cone.

Step-by-step explanation:

Given that,

The volume of a right circular cone is 300 cubic inches

We need to find the volume of a  right cylinder that  has the same base and height as the cone.

Volume of a cone is given by :

[tex]V=\dfrac{1}{3}\pi r^2h[/tex]

And volume of a cylinder is given by :

[tex]V'=\pi r'^2 h'[/tex]

If the base and height of cone and cylinder are same, r=r' and h=h'

[tex]\dfrac{V}{V'}=\dfrac{1/3\pi r^2 h}{\pi r'^2h'}\\\\=\dfrac{1/3\pi r^2 h}{\pi r^2h}\\\\\dfrac{V}{V'}=\dfrac{1}{3}\\\\V'=3V[/tex]

So, the volume of a right cylinder is equal to the 3 times of the volume of a right circular cone.
